Renowned singer Angie Stone, who touched the hearts of the public with her legendary hit "Wish I Didn't Miss You," has died at the age of 63 after a tragic car accident.
The news was confirmed by the artist's representative, who said that the accident occurred in Montgomery, Alabama, as Stone was returning home from a performance. She was the only victim of the accident.
Angie Stone was a powerful voice in soul and R&B music, leaving behind a rich artistic legacy that will be remembered for generations to come.
